The Mission Soil Manifesto brings together a range of stakeholders who care for soil health. 
The Signatories of the Mission Soil Manifesto represent a diverse group of legal entities including municipalities, regions, NGOs, research institutions, agricultural communities and private companies. They are committed to addressing the urgent challenges facing our soils and promoting sustainable land management practices.
